Storm Collectibles Teases 1:12 Ultimate Mortal Kombat 3 Scorpion Figure

by Jay Cochran
May 23, 2019
Storm Collectibles today has released an image for what seems to be teasing an upcoming 1:12 scale Ultimate Mortal Kombat 3 based Scorpion figure. The image seems to show the Axe weapon that Scorpion uses in that version of the game. Check out the tease image below and stay-tuned for more details on this as they become available.

Scorpion Hanzo Hasashi was once a member of the Japanese Shirai Ryu ninja Clan. Given the name Scorpion for deadly fighting skills, his life was blessed with glorious kombat in the name of his Grand Master. His signature move is his spear and hellfire. When his mask is removed, his head is a (flaming) skull. Scorpion is a fan favourite, appearing regularly since Mortal Kombat Klassic.Product Features:Newly developed body with new joints2 x interchanging Mask / Skull Mask4 x interchanging hands1 x Axe1 x Scorpion Spear "get over here!"3 x Blood EffectThis figure will first be made available at the San Diego Comic Con next month and then see a general release in October.
